WebHence, in a player with any suspicion of cervical spine injury (See spinal injury chapter) head tilt and chin lift should not be used, and jaw thrust should be used instead. Jaw Thrust. The jaw thrust does not change the alignment of the neck and can therefore be used in a player with suspected cervical spine injury. Jaw-thrust maneuver - Wikiwand

WebThe jaw-thrust maneuver is a first aid and medical procedure used to prevent the tongue from obstructing the upper airways. Webin the pharynx, bronchial tree, or trachea. Symptoms include gurgling, wheezing, stridor, retractions, hypoxemia, and hypercapnia. Treatment includes administering 100% oxygen, suctioning of secretions, jaw-thrust maneuver to maintain airway, and insertion of an oral or nasal airway.
